With over 200 traces to test your knowledge, this book is a first class learning tool for emergency physicians. Basic student level knowledge of ECGs is assumed, so the reader can move directly to learning about the more complex traces that occur in the emergency department. The level of difficulty is stratified into two sections for:


  • Specialists in training

  • Specialist emergency physicians

A minimum amount of information is given beneath each trace, as if in the real situation. The full clinical description is printed in a separate section to avoid the temptation of "looking".

Accompanied by learning points, and with the cases presented randomly, this book provides a rich source of information on the interpretation of ECGs - a core skill for all emergency department staff.
